KARACHI: Class IX (Gen) results



By Our Staff Reporter


KARACHI, Aug 17: The Board of Secondary Education, Karachi, on Wednesday declared the results of Secondary School Certificate (SSC) General group Part-I (Class IX) Annual Examinations 2005.

As many as 19,877 candidates, including 13,122 girls, cleared all five papers. The overall percentage of those clearing all papers remained 53.14.

According to a BSE notification, 37,406 regular and private candidates, including 24,724 girls, appeared in the exams.

The breakdown of candidates having cleared different numbers of papers is as follows: five papers 19,877 (3,421 private), four papers 8,258 (1,701), three papers 4,480 (857), two papers 2,525 (545) and one paper 1,505 (352).
